19暑期学习-Day1

2019-07-06  本文已影响0人  iqxtreme

内容概要

  • 了解virtualbox的基本使用
  • 在虚拟机上安装centos
  • 在centos中安装lnmp

1 下载VirtualBox & 扩展包

ftp位置:/VR训练营/学习资料/centos/

2 安装VirtualBox & 扩展包

3 下载Centos6

ftp位置:/VR训练营/学习资料/centos/

4 安装centos之前的准备

4.1 配置VirtualBox虚拟网卡

windows版本可能默认已经配置好一块。
启动VBox,打开“主机网络管理器”。查看是否已经有一块网卡,没有就创建一块。


主机网络管理器
windows上由VBox自动创建的虚拟网卡

4.2 创建虚拟主机

1


创建主机1/3

2 文件大小最好设置为5GB以上,否则后面装lnmp可能经常失败。


创建主机2/3
3
创建主机3/3

问题小结:

  • 若无64位系统可选,则是因为硬件虚拟化未开启,需要进入bios开启

4.3 配置主机

1 进入主机配置


配置主机1/4

2 如果觉得声音没有必要,可以关闭声音


配置主机2/4
3 网卡1的配置:网络地址转换(NAT)
配置主机3/4

4 网卡2的配置:仅主机(Host-Onlyi)网络,及界面名称(vboxnet???或????host-only???)


配置主机4/4

问题小结:

  • 若出现下列提示,则是因为硬件虚拟化未开启,需要进入bios开启。


    发现无效设置

5 安装centos

Basic Storage Devices Yes, discard any data

6 检查centos网络状况

主要检测以下通路


需要检测的通路
ip address

检查网卡配置情况,如下图:


虚拟机网卡配置
ping www.baidu.com
外网可以ping通

ctrl+c退出ping过程。

ping 192.168.56.1

宿主机对于虚拟主机而言的ip为192.168.56.1


宿主机可以连通
ping 192.168.56.101

虚拟机对于宿主机的ip可以通过ip address命令打印出的信息中eth1看到,通常为192.168.56.101。


宿主机可以连通虚拟机

问题小结:

  • 虚拟机ping不通宿主机,可能宿主机虚拟网卡ip需要加入防火墙白名单或者关闭防火墙。


    设置规则解决ping问题

7 更新centos开发环境

此处会多次用到yum指令,这是centos下的包管理指令。

yum install wget
yum update kernel
shutdown -r now
yum install kernel-devel gcc gcc-c++

8 安装lnmp

mkdir /home/downloads/
cd /home/downloads/
wget http://soft1.vpser.net/lnmp/lnmp1.6.tar.gz 

下载完成可以使用ln命令,看看下载的文件

ls
tar zxf lnmp1.6.tar.gz
mkdir /home/src/
mv /home/downloads/lnmp1.6 /home/src
cd /home/src/lnmp1.6
./install.sh lnmp

Day1 任务结束


上一篇 下一篇

猜你喜欢

热点阅读